summaryrefslogtreecommitdiffstats
path: root/fs/ocfs2/dlm/dlmmaster.c
Commit message (Expand)AuthorAgeFilesLines
* ocfs2/dlm: use bitmap API instead of hand-writing itJoseph Qi2022-11-181-15/+15
* all: replace find_next{,_zero}_bit with find_first{,_zero}_bit where appropriateYury Norov2022-01-151-9/+9
* ocfs2: remove redundant assignment to pointer queueColin Ian King2021-06-291-1/+1
* treewide: remove editor modelines and cruftMasahiro Yamada2021-05-071-3/+1
* ocfs2: add missing annotation for dlm_empty_lockres()Jules Irenge2020-06-021-0/+1
* ocfs2: remove unused macrosAlex Shi2020-04-021-2/+0
* ocfs2: make local header paths relative to C filesMasahiro Yamada2020-01-311-4/+4
* fs: ocfs: remove unnecessary assertion in dlm_migrate_lockresAditya Pakki2020-01-311-2/+0
* fs: ocfs: fix spelling mistake "hearbeating" -> "heartbeat"ChenGang2019-07-121-1/+1
* tre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 145Thomas Gleixner2019-05-301-16/+1
* ocfs2: fix locking for res->tracking and dlm->tracking_listAshish Samant2018-10-051-2/+2
* ocfs2: correct spelling mistake for migratable for allChangwei Ge2018-04-051-4/+4
* ocfs2: fix spelling mistake: "Migrateable" -> "Migratable"Colin Ian King2018-04-051-1/+1
* ocfs2: remove unnecessary null pointer check before kmem_cache_destroy()piaojun2018-04-051-10/+5
* fs/ocfs2/dlm/dlmmaster.c: clean up dead codeChangwei Ge2018-01-311-7/+0
* ocfs2/dlm: get mle inuse only when it is initializedChangwei Ge2017-11-151-1/+3
* scripts/spelling.txt: add "unneded" pattern and fix typo instancesMasahiro Yamada2017-02-271-1/+1
* locking/atomic, kref: Add kref_read()Peter Zijlstra2017-01-141-4/+4
* ocfs2/dlm: clean up deadcode in dlm_master_request_handler()piaojun2016-12-121-6/+0
* ocfs2: delete redundant code and set the node bit into maybe_map directlyGuozhonghua2016-12-121-4/+1
* ocfs2: fix memory leak in dlm_migrate_request_handler()Guozhonghua2016-10-111-0/+3
* ocfs2/dlm: continue to purge recovery lockres when recovery master goes downpiaojun2016-08-021-34/+3
* ocfs2/dlm: solve a BUG when deref failed in dlm_drop_lockres_refpiaojun2016-08-021-3/+6
* ocfs2/dlm: disable BUG_ON when DLM_LOCK_RES_DROPPING_REF is cleared before dl...piaojun2016-08-021-2/+11
* ocfs2/dlm: return zero if deref_done message is successfully handledxuejiufei2016-04-281-0/+2
* ocfs2: fix a tiny race that leads file system read-onlyJiufei Xue2016-03-151-1/+2
* ocfs2/dlm: return in progress if master can not clear the refmap bit right nowxuejiufei2016-03-151-3/+5
* ocfs2/dlm: add DEREF_DONE messagexuejiufei2016-03-151-0/+116
* ocfs2/dlm: do not insert a new mle when another process is already migratingxuejiufei2016-01-141-2/+3
* ocfs2/dlm: ignore cleaning the migration mle that is inusexuejiufei2016-01-141-11/+15
* ocfs2/dlm: return appropriate value when dlm_grab() returns NULLXue jiufei2016-01-141-1/+1
* ocfs2/dlm: wait until DLM_LOCK_RES_SETREF_INPROG is cleared in dlm_deref_lock...jiangyiwen2016-01-141-1/+1
* ocfs2/dlm: clear migration_pending when migration target goes downxuejiufei2015-12-291-0/+2
* ocfs2/dlm: unlock lockres spinlock before dlm_lockres_putJoseph Qi2015-10-231-1/+2
* ocfs2/dlm: fix deadlock when dispatch assert masterJoseph Qi2015-09-221-3/+6
* ocfs2: avoid access invalid address when read o2dlm debug messagesYiwen Jiang2015-09-041-11/+11
* ocfs2: dlm: fix race between purge and get lock resourceJunxiao Bi2015-05-051-0/+13
* ocfs2/dlm: fix race between dispatched_work and dlm_lockres_grab_inflight_workerJoseph Qi2014-12-181-9/+3
* ocfs2: o2dlm: fix a race between purge and master querySrinivas Eeda2014-12-101-0/+12
* ocfs2: remove unused code in dlm_new_lockres()Xue jiufei2014-10-091-3/+0
* ocfs2/dlm: should put mle when goto kill in dlm_assert_master_handleralex chen2014-10-021-0/+4
* ocfs2/dlm: do not get resource spinlock if lockres is newJoseph Qi2014-09-261-8/+10
* ocfs2: race between umount and unfinished remastering during recoveryTariq Saeed2014-08-061-0/+4
* ocfs2/dlm: do not purge lockres that is queued for assert masterXue jiufei2014-06-231-1/+42
* ocfs2: do not return DLM_MIGRATE_RESPONSE_MASTERY_REF to avoid endless,loop d...jiangyiwen2014-06-231-5/+9
* ocfs2: remove NULL assignments on staticFabian Frederick2014-06-041-3/+3
* ocfs2: fix double kmem_cache_destroy in dlm_initJoseph Qi2014-05-231-2/+6
* ocfs2: break useless while loopJunxiao Bi2013-11-131-1/+3
* ocfs2: delay migration when the lockres is in migration stateXue jiufei2013-11-131-0/+4
* ocfs2: use list_for_each_entry() instead of list_for_each()Dong Fang2013-09-111-13/+5